Folks, The IPCDN WG will meet in Minneapolis, MN on Monday, March 19th, 2001, between 1:00pm-3:00pm. The topics I would hope to see covered include the following: * WG charter revision update (latest charter posted January 23rd to the mailing list) * Euromodem NIU MIB and Interface MIB <http://www.ietf.org/internet-drafts/draft-ietf-ipcdn-dvbnetint-mib-03.txt> <http://www.ietf.org/internet-drafts/draft-ietf-ipcdn-dvbniuif-mib-00.txt> * DOCSIS 1.1 QoS MIB update in progress? * DOCSIS 1.1 Notifications update in progress * DOCSIS Subscriber Management MIB update <http://www.ietf.org/internet-drafts/draft-ietf-ipcdn-subscriber-mib-03.txt> (I need to see the final cable operator requirements/statement from someone at CableLabs) * RFC 2669/2670 (DOCSIS Cable Device MIB and RF Interface MIB) updates (RFC 2670 update posted February 23rd to the mailing list, RFC 2669 update in progress) * BPI+ MIB update in progress? * DOCSIS Usage of RFC 2933 MIB update in progress * Account Management Control MIB unknown progress -- is this effort worthwhile? Authors: could you let Andy Valentine and I know if you are working on a presentation? if so, who will be presenting it? I would really appreciate two additional presentations: "CableLabs Perspectives on IPv6" (which impacts almost every MIB in this WG), and "Technical Issues with Multiple CMs in the Same Subscriber Premise" (which is being considered by the CableHome project, <http://www.cablelabs.com/homenetworks/>, and creates lots of new CM requirements). I would also like to remind internet-draft authors that the deadline for submitting updated drafts is this Friday, March 2nd, 5:00pm EST. Here is an update on the status of several IPCDN specifications: - The DOCSIS BPI MIB is in the RFC Editor's queue for publication as an informational RFC. - The Euromodem NIU MIB is in WG last-call.
